CodeZineを運営する翔泳社より、12月18日(月)に書籍『実装で学ぶフルスタックWeb開発 エンジニアの視野と知識を広げる「一気通貫」型ハンズオン』が発売となりました。
現代的なWeb開発の現場では分業が当たり前になり、例えばフロントエンドの担当者はバックエンドについてまったく知らない・わからない状態になりがちです。しかし、全体を見通す視野と知識を持ち、様々な工程における効率的な手法を知っておくことは自分が担当する領域でも役立ちますし、なによりワンランク上のWebエンジニアになるには不可欠です。
本書ではWeb開発のノウハウを身につけたい方のために、フロントエンドとバックエンドそれぞれの動作原理や開発テクニックを解説しています。実際にハンズオンでフルスタックのWeb開発を体験できるので、でフロントエンドとバックエンドをどのように連携させるか、リポジトリを効率的に管理するにはどうするか、設計情報をどのように共有するかといった重要なポイントを手と体で学べます。
ハンズオンでの実装には「Next.js」と「Django」を利用しているので、モダンなWeb開発の手法を知るのにも役立ちます。現場で幅広く活躍したい方に、フルスタックなノウハウを提供する1冊です。
目次
第I部 Webシステム開発の基本
第1章 Webシステム開発の基本知識
第2章 React(Next.js)+Django(Python)環境の構築
第3章 VSCode+Dockerでの開発
第4章 フロントエンドとバックエンドのシステム連携の基本
第II部 Webシステム開発の実践
第5章 フロントエンドの実装
第6章 バックエンドの実装とフロントエンドとのシステム連携
第7章 非同期処理とバッチ処理の実装
第8章 データ構造・マスタデータの管理
第III部 現場で役立つ周辺知識
第9章 チームビルディング
第10章 設計
第11章 Gitによるリポジトリ管理
読者特典PDF
特典A アーキテクチャの選定
特典B 本番環境の構築
この記事は参考になりましたか?
- この記事の著者
-
渡部 拓也(ワタナベ タクヤ)
翔泳社マーケティング課。MarkeZine、CodeZine、EnterpriseZine、Biz/Zine、ほかにて翔泳社の本の紹介記事や著者インタビュー、たまにそれ以外も執筆しています。
※プロフィールは、執筆時点、または直近の記事の寄稿時点での内容です
【AD】本記事の内容は記事掲載開始時点のものです 企画・制作 株式会社翔泳社